Sequence of Lifts Together
In this video, Jeff Amsden teaches the proper technique for executing lifts. Join him as he covers such topics as hand placement, the use of your legs while lifting, supporting your lower back, timing and many other important factors necessary to execute lifts safely. Finally, this breathtaking lift is broken down in a step-by-step manner so that anyone can learn to perform it. Adding this beautiful movement to your choreography will bring an exciting element to any style of choreography whether ballet, lyrical-contemporary, jazz or musical theater. Dance Companies: Joffrey Ballet Concert Group, Chamber Ballet USA. Television: The Academy Awards, The American Music Awards, Dancin’ to the Hits, Blowing Kisses in the Wind partnering Paula Abdul, 100th Anniversary of the Statue of Liberty TV Special, Coach, The Tracy Ullman Show, The Guiding Light. Film: “Cinderella” with Brandy and Whitney Houston, “Back to the Future 2,” “And the Band Played On.” Commercials: Stickletts Gum, Teddy Grahams cookies and Miller Lite. Theater: Phantom of the Opera (original LA cast), Jerome Robbins’ Broadway (original workshop production). Choreography: A Few Good Men Dancin’, Grease at the Paper Mill Playhouse, All My Children, The Guiding Light, Asst choreographer Saturday Night Fever (original West End production), The Elan Awards honoring Susan Stroman. www.jamsden.com
Katy Spreadbury is dancer/teacher/choreographer from Worcester, Massachusetts. As a young artist she was named Miss Dance of America, and can currently be found teaching and performing throughout the country with LA Dance Magic.
